Type
ORACLE
Validation date
2024-12-02 06:30: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01839,
    "usd": 0.01936
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019F78A57991205669512E8985CA1567E85EFF831BDAF679C7DCAC702808F54566

Previous signature

CC403887D921F484375CD0B9968F88FA62BDA925B2DC2D627EA708174C924EBFF44EAFE5D21AE409F9B7CF909F17BC7D530B8409FE729CDF8B3912647162C30E

Origin signature

3045022059D3A2B91F258A63DAABC1596C4406CF634C707D2C2E3ACCF498B42F1EBD32FC02210094FC723B53F7FAAE5A7B52A7A191FBC5C2965A440406E1BB43266EBCBB75351E

Proof of work

010104294BD98CA56FA4D6BF0A5157D36210B3E0B8FE1EFD897F77F88F6C0C07FE68F43D0B2E1F6C27E9A902D7C311E0491EC75EB2406FD7B60705ACF4909E2DC026D9

Proof of integrity

009D88D831347F464AF6B062711603F41105A1462799F5A8381C03CFFFC6B122E7

Coordinator signature

8A14EB33B94689F912F7C26172CAE6CE07BEDE082CA59A0612644F8A733841A2CFA106C06A36D45E06DB93DF0862973FE280E4AB041C800309866BEB59C11D05

Validator #1 public key

0001B9E2941895A3951F10CE0D7978DD083C3D8A19ACE27F4F98798DF04045B11181

Validator #1 signature

BECC1173B243C46EA385F4E1D3F0F4634980138C9DB392EBBFA57E400ADEBDC9EAC4601DA28C27F281082E6C6CF49A8D3D8559FD928DF5E3420D2DCF2E70F90D

Validator #2 public key

0001EC6E55F66EF1FB64146A826C46268B1995E8EC834680FB3E41C831DB6613E255

Validator #2 signature

981C6548AF0FC7A3AED9666C1495E90F660D7D0512427B20878E512B3FBD68373ADD3867D76D1D5D75735A054FF579804988DB10987C383E759A12950798E90D